Hello all,

I am Niteesh, one of the students selected under Google Summer of Code 2021
to work on the project Interactive, asynchronous QMP TUI.
Link to my proposal: https://docs.google.com/document/d/1o_U9txCyqZDYIqqhj4V0IEO9-20KY2pb4egi75ueXco/edit?usp=sharing

The goal of this project is to get an interactive and asynchronous TUI interface
that is capable of connecting to the AQMP server and communicate with it.

My experience with async stuff and AQMP is writing a chat application to
better understand python's asyncio and trying to connect the UI to AQMP.
The UI built for chatting basically worked as a primitive interface to send and
receive QMP commands. The below video demonstrates this.
https://github.com/gs-niteesh/Async-Chat-App/blob/master/qemu.mp4

By end of this summer, I would like to get a basic TUI with some desirable
features working. Some of the features I would like to get working are
1) Syntax checking
2) Syntax highlighting
3) Code completion
4) Logging

I would like to hear some of the features you would like to have and also your
advice's on implementation.
